The Kings Maiesties propositions to the gentry and commonalty of Nottingham. . Who according to His Majesties command made their appearance neere unto the citie of Nottingham. With the answer of the gentry to the Kings Majesties propositions, declaring their full resolution concerning the standerd, ... likewise, happy newes from Northampton, signifying the skirmish they had there with the Cavaleers, Septem. 2. And the manner how they beat them off from the towne, ... As also some passages from Portsmouth.
